From: Xu Rao Date: Thu, 25 Jun 2026 13:29:03 +0000 (+0800) Subject: ACPI: TAD: Check AC wake capability before enabling wakeup X-Git-Tag: v7.2-rc2~11^2^2 X-Git-Url: http://git.ipfire.org/?a=commitdiff_plain;h=8522d806d84e2c3816c275ae6dd79e124c1b3dac;p=thirdparty%2Fkernel%2Flinux.git ACPI: TAD: Check AC wake capability before enabling wakeup ACPI_TAD_AC_WAKE is a non-zero bit definition, so testing the macro itself is always true. As a result, every TAD device is initialized as a system wakeup device, including RTC-only devices and devices whose wake capability bits were cleared because _PRW is absent. Test the capability value returned by _GCP instead. This keeps RTC-only TAD devices usable without advertising a wakeup capability that the firmware does not provide.
